Teltonika RUT260 4G LTE Cat 6 Industrial Cellular Router
The Teltonika RUT260 is a compact and rugged industrial 4G LTE Cat 6 cellular router designed for reliable connectivity in IoT, industrial automation, utilities, remote monitoring and enterprise applications. It combines LTE Cat 6 speeds up to 300 Mbps, Wi-Fi, two Ethernet ports, digital I/O and automatic WAN failover in a very compact industrial enclosure.
The RUT260 runs Teltonika's RutOS operating system and supports a wide range of industrial and IoT protocols including Modbus TCP, MQTT, BACnet, OPC UA, DNP3 and DLMS/COSEM, making it much more than a basic 4G router.

4G LTE Cat 6 with Carrier Aggregation
The RUT260 uses an LTE Cat 6 modem with Carrier Aggregation, providing maximum theoretical speeds of:
- Download: up to 300 Mbps
- Upload: up to 50 Mbps
- 3G fallback: up to 42 Mbps download / 5.76 Mbps upload
Carrier Aggregation allows compatible mobile networks to combine LTE spectrum resources, providing better throughput than standard LTE Cat 4 routers.
This makes the RUT260 suitable for industrial installations that require more bandwidth while still maintaining a compact and cost-effective router design.
Automatic WAN Failover
One of the key features of the RUT260 is automatic network failover.
The router can use:
- 4G mobile
- Wired WAN
- Wi-Fi WAN
- VRRP
as network connectivity options, with automatic switching to an available backup connection if the primary WAN fails. It also supports load balancing across multiple WAN connections.
This is particularly useful for remote monitoring, industrial equipment, security systems and other applications where loss of internet connectivity could interrupt operations.
Wi-Fi Connectivity
The RUT260 includes 802.11b/g/n Wi-Fi 4 and can operate as either:
- Access Point (AP)
- Station (STA)
It supports up to 50 simultaneous Wi-Fi connections and includes modern wireless features such as 802.11s wireless mesh, 802.11r fast roaming, 802.11v BSS transition management and 802.11k radio resource measurement.
Security options include WPA2 and WPA3, enterprise authentication, MAC filtering and protected management frames.

Industrial IoT Protocols
A major advantage of the RUT260 is its extensive built-in industrial protocol support.
Modbus TCP
The router can operate as both a:
- Modbus TCP Client
- Modbus TCP Server
It supports INT, UINT, floating-point, HEX and ASCII data formats, including ABCD, DCBA, CDAB and BADC 32-bit byte ordering.

Digital Input & Output
The RUT260 provides:
- 1 × Digital Input
- 1 × Digital Open Collector Output
The input detects 0–6 V as logic low and 8–30 V as logic high.
The digital output supports a maximum of 30 V / 300 mA.
Events can trigger Email, RMS or SMS notifications, while Teltonika's I/O Juggler allows I/O conditions to initiate configurable actions.
This can be useful for applications such as equipment status monitoring, alarms, door monitoring and basic remote control.

Compact Rugged Industrial Design
One of the strongest advantages of the RUT260 is its compact size.
The enclosure measures only:
83 × 25 × 74 mm
and weighs approximately 130 g.
Despite the small footprint, it uses an aluminium housing with plastic panels and operates from -40°C to +75°C. DIN rail, wall and flat-surface mounting options are available with additional mounting kits.
This makes the RUT260 particularly suitable for small electrical cabinets, control panels, kiosks and other installations where space is limited.
Flexible 9–30 VDC Power
The RUT260 accepts 9–30 VDC through its industrial 4-pin connector and incorporates reverse-polarity and surge/transient protection.
Power consumption is low:
- Idle: <2 W
- Maximum: <6.5 W
The router can also be powered through passive PoE using the LAN port. This is Mode B 9–30 VDC passive PoE and is not compatible with IEEE 802.3af/at/bt PoE.
Technical Specifications
| Feature |
Specification |
| Cellular |
4G LTE Cat 6 |
| Maximum Download |
Up to 300 Mbps |
| Maximum Upload |
Up to 50 Mbps |
| Carrier Aggregation |
Yes |
| SIM |
1 × Mini SIM (2FF) |
| eSIM |
Optional hardware version |
| Wi-Fi |
Wi-Fi 4 – 802.11b/g/n |
| Wi-Fi Users |
Up to 50 |
| Ethernet |
2 × 10/100 Mbps |
| WAN |
1 × WAN, configurable as LAN |
| LAN |
1 × LAN |
| Digital Input |
1 |
| Digital Output |
1 × Open Collector |
| Industrial Protocols |
Modbus, MQTT, BACnet, OPC UA, DNP3, DLMS/COSEM |
| Operating System |
RutOS – OpenWrt-based Linux |
| CPU |
MediaTek 580 MHz MIPS 24KEc |
| RAM |
128 MB DDR2 |
| Flash |
16 MB |
| Power Input |
9–30 VDC |
| Passive PoE |
Yes, 9–30 VDC Mode B |
| Power Consumption |
<2 W idle / <6.5 W max |
| Operating Temperature |
-40°C to +75°C |
| Housing |
Aluminium with plastic panels |
| Protection |
IP30 |
| Dimensions |
83 × 25 × 74 mm |
| Weight |
130 g |
